PAY-PER-VIEW* AND ON DEMAND*
Where available, Pay-Per-View and On Demand are for private, in-home viewing
only; no commercial establishments. To order one of these services, your account
must be current. Customers with digital receivers may order using Charter’s remote
control. To prevent unauthorized use in your household, you are responsible for
setting up a PIN number, Parental Control and Rating preference. Charter will not give
credit for the following circumstances: 1) unauthorized use, 2) if you tape a Pay-Per-
View event or movie and are not present to monitor the taping, 3) if you do not call to
report reception problems while the movie or event you ordered is on, 4) or if you do
not call to report you did not receive the movie you ordered, while that movie is on.

ADDITIONAL EQUIPMENT
Cable jumpers, signal splitters, amplifiers or A/B switches may cause signal
degradation if they do not meet Charter’s standards. Please contact us for assistance
in connecting any additional equipment to your home network. All cable connections
must be properly prepared and must be properly tightened.

SPECIAL EQUIPMENT
BYPASS SWITCHES/SPLITTERS: This switch is installed on the input side of the receiver
to permit signals to bypass the receiver and be routed directly to your television set,
DVD or VCR. This will permit the simultaneous recording and viewing of different non-
secure programs, the consecutive recording of non-secure programming on different
channels, and the use of picture in picture features for non-secure channels. This
switch may be part of your receiver or it may be a separate device.
CUSTOM SETUP: If you wish to receive two secure channels at the same time (so that
you can watch a secure channel while recording another secure channel), a dual
tuner receiver or two single tuner receivers can be installed to facilitate this request.
AMPLIFICATION EQUIPMENT: Charter is required by federal regulation to deliver a
minimum signal to each television set. Charter’s network is designed to provide the
required signal for up to four home devices. If five or more outlets or devices are
connected to the home network, a signal amplification device may be required and
may be sold to the respective customer. Charter will install the amplification device.
CABLECARDs: The CableCARD is a piece of equipment, about the size of a credit card,
designed to allow a customer to see digital encrypted cable channels without using a
receiver if you have a newer television that supports the device. In some instances, a
receiver is still needed to receive advanced interactive digital cable services, including
but not limited to, On Demand, on screen ordering of Pay-Per-View or the enhanced
program guide. Please contact Charter to inquire about the availability of CableCARDs
in your area.

PARENTAL CONTROLS
Charter understands that there may be certain television programs available that
some customers find unsuitable for members of their household. Certain channels
containing sexually oriented programming are carried on the cable system. Signal
“bleed”, which results in partly discernible video images and audio, may appear on
these and other channels. Charter advises all customers to periodically audit the
cable channels to determine if any programming is deemed by them to be offensive
or inappropriate, as well as to prevent children from viewing signal “bleed” without
their parents’ knowledge or permission. Customers should also be aware that certain
home electronic equipment may be capable of “defeating” scrambled signals and
may make it possible to view the programming involved.
A parental control option is available to all Charter customers who have a receiver
hooked up to their TV. In some areas, one of our remote controls may also be
necessary in order to utilize this option.
Depending on the type of equipment in your home, parentally controlling a channel
may be as easy as pressing some buttons on the remote control or the receiver.
By exercising the parental control option, you can block the programming on many
channels for a certain amount of time. In most areas, our equipment allows our
customers to parentally control even local broadcast networks.
